Output e106dc21094ff7f679b252d57c59316914e58ef1d2a4087423d326eb53549f01:0

value
4319680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 653b18ec31960a9d293a17ad0bb369fd8e20f652 OP_EQUALVERIFY OP_CHECKSIG
address
1AEG3XoLcreDVY3yqYgu3TZbQw2rDCKFta
transaction
e106dc21094ff7f679b252d57c59316914e58ef1d2a4087423d326eb53549f01
spent
true